After a life of small-time crime you've been accepted into America's most powerful criminal organization—the Corleone Family. Now it's up to you to carry out orders, earn respect, rise through the ranks, and make New York City your own. Choose your path in the world of The Godfather in this game custom-built for next gen systems with new content, improved gameplay, upgraded graphics, motion-sensing controls, and more. Take on a variety of action-packed missions, including mob hits, bank heists, and extortion, plus all-new missions and contract hits, in a fully living New York City. Play your cards right and you could become the next, and most powerful, Don.

Features


The World of The Godfather, Rebuilt for Next Gen -The authentic The Godfather experience reaches a new with much more content than the current gen version of the game, including new hits, compounds, families, hubs, mini-games, and more.
The Power of Intimidation - Wield the power of the BlackHand like never before with new Sixaxis motion-sensing controls.
Do It Your Way - The non-linear action-adventure gameplay features original and film-based missions, including all-new missions.
Develop Your Character - The new RPG system lets you choose your path as an Enforcer for better fighting skills or an Operator with a gift for extorting and influencing others.
Respect and Consequences - Use your powers of loyalty and fear to earn respect. How you go about gaining power — through negotiation, intimidation, or a strategic mix of both — affects how others deal with you.
More Explosive Action - Mafia warfare gets more intense on next gen with new car bombs, hard-hitting Corleone strike teams, and more.
Director's Cut Content - View bonus behind-the-scenes and making-of videos, only on the PLAYSTATION 3 system version of the game!
